RANGE REVIEW: RENEWABLES & SUSTAINABILITY


REGENERATIVE FARMING FOR THE NATION’S GARDENS


B&Q is responding to the need for more environmentally conscious gardening methods with the launch of MamaTerra by Verve, which includes ingredients sourced from nature, making it easier for customers to make more sustainable choices for their gardens nationwide.


from nature, that are free from synthetic chemicals - as home improvement retailers look to make it easier than ever for gardeners to adopt more environmentally conscious gardening methods and preserve carbon in soil. Replenishing and restoring the world’s soils – in farming, natural landscapes as well as household gardens – could help remove up to 5.5 billion tonnes of CO2 every year. That is equivalent to the annual greenhouse emissions of the US. Whilst these kinds of regenerative agricultural practices, which protect soil and preserve carbon have been on the rise for farmers, they are relatively unknown amongst UK household gardeners. the UK garden landscape and make more


environmentally conscious


gardening methods, such as no dig gardening, accessible to all. No dig gardening involves applying organic matter, such as the MamaTerra by Verve compost, to the soil surface, so the natural


process of decomposition is emulated, rather than digging the soil to remove weeds or plant seeds. This stops the disruption of soil structure and organisms, allowing the soil’s ecosystem to remain intact and the carbon to be preserved in the soil.


Sourced from nature The MamaTerra by Verve products are made with ingredients sourced from nature which work with the ecology of the garden, helping to support a more resilient and fertile soil. To help enable more sustainable


gardening, B&Q has created a complete ecosystem of gardening products that help to enrich the soil and encourage natural microbes found in soil. The new range supports the full plant lifecycle, from no-dig soil improving composts to plant feed and plant protection, all made with ingredients sourced from nature – making it easier than ever for customers to make more sustainable choices.
